검색 상세

유비쿼터스 공간에서의 서비스 충돌인지 기반 동적 서비스 구성 방식

Dynamic Service Configuration based on Service Collision-Awareness in Ubiquitous Space

  • 발행기관 亞洲大學校 大學院
  • 지도교수 尹元植
  • 발행년도 2005
  • 학위수여년월 2005. 2
  • 학위명 석사
  • 학과 및 전공 일반대학원 전자공학과
  • 본문언어 한국어

초록/요약

유비쿼터스 공간내에서 사용자가 어플리케이션 서비스를 인접한 디바이스를 사용하여 제공받기 위해서는 적절한 접근제어 방식이 필요하다. RBAC(Role-based access control) 방식은 이러한 서비스 접근제어를 위해 제안된 방식으로, RBAC 방식은 사용자 개개인에게 권한을 부여하는 것이 아닌 사용자의 역할(role)에 따라 권한을 주는 방식이다. 또한 유연적인 서비스 제공을 위해 다양한 서비스 접근모드가 존재하며, 이러한 모드는 사용자와 물리적 혹은 가상적 디바이스와 적절한 협업을 통해 이루어진다. 하지만 한정된 공유 디바이스를 여러 사람이 사용할 경우 어플리케이션 서비스 제공 요청시 서비스 충돌이 발생하며, 서비스 제공 전달시간 지연이 발생하는 단점이 있다. 본 논문에서는 서비스 충돌을 회피할 수 있는 효율적인 시스템 구조도를 설명하고, 이를 위한 수정된 서비스 세션 테이블을 제안하여 서비스 충돌회피 절차를 제안하였다. 제안된 방식은 서비스 충돌을 인지하여 이를 회피함으로써 불필요한 서비스 요청메시지를 감소시키며 또한 사용가능한 디바이스에게 직접 서비스를 요청함으로써 서비스 제공 전달시간을 줄일 수 있음을 확인할 수 있다. 따라서 제안된 방식은 퍼스널 서버로 하여금 효율적으로 배터리를 소비하게 하며, 신속한 서비스를 제공받을 수 있게 하는 장점이 있다.

more

초록/요약

Access control mechanisms are necessary to give the appropriate application service between the authorized users and adjacent devices. RBAC (Role-based Access Control) has been proposed to support the authorized services. The fundamental concept of RBAC is that permissions are associated with roles rather than user, thus separating the assignment of users to roles from the assignment of permissions to roles. And the different mode can cooperate between groups of users, and the dependence between physical and virtual aspects of ubiquitous environments. But when many users want to use limited devices, service collision happens. So personal server will send unnecessary service request message, and can’t use the application service immediately. We present the system architecture for service collision avoidance and propose the modified service session table and service collision avoidance scheme. The analysis results show that the proposed scheme reduces the number of unnecessary service request messages and service provisioning delivery time. Therefore PS uses the battery efficiently and can use the service rapidly.

more

목차

목차
목차 = ⅰ
약어표 = ⅳ
그림목차 = ⅴ
표목차 = ⅵ
국문요약 = ⅷ
제 1 장 서론 = 1
제 2 장 기존의 접근제어 및 서비스 구성기법 = 4
제 1 절 Role-based Access Control = 4
제 2 절 서비스 구성 기법 및 예약 기법 = 11
제 3 절 기존의 접근제어 및 서비스 구성기법의 문제점 = 14
제 3 장 제안한 서비스 충돌인지 기반 서비스 구성 기법 = 17
제 1 절 전체 시스템 구조도 = 17
제 2 절 서비스 충돌회피를 위한 수정된 서비스 세션 테이블 = 19
제 3 절 제안한 서비스 충돌회피 기반의 접근제어 방식 = 20
제 4 절 상황인지 기반 서비스 예약 구성기법 = 25
제 4 장 성능분석 = 27
제 1 절 성능분석 환경 = 27
제 2 절 제안한 서비스 충돌회피 기반 접근제어방식에 대한 성능분석 = 29
1. 충돌된 서비스 요청메시지 = 29
2. 서비스 제공 전달시간 = 29
제 3 절 성능분석 결과 및 토의 = 31
1. 충돌된 서비스 요청메시지 = 31
2. 서비스 제공 전달시간 = 33
제 5 장 결론 = 35
Acknowlegement = 36
참고 문헌 = 37
Abstract = 39

more

목차

그림 목차
그림 1. RBAC(Role-based Access Control) 모델 = 4
그림 2. 계층화된 역할모델 = 5
그림 3. Group mode에서의 서비스 충돌 = 15
그림 4. Group mode에서의 서비스 제공 지연 = 16
그림 5. 서비스 충돌인지 기반 서비스 접근제어 및 서비스 구성을 위한 시스템 구조도 = 18
그림 6. 서비스 충돌인지 기반 서비스 요청메시지 흐름도 = 23
그림 7. 우선순위 기반 서비스 협상절차 메시지 흐름도 = 24
그림 8. Loosed-coupled session에서의 서비스 세션 재구성 메시지 흐름도 = 26
그림 9. 충돌된 서비스 요청메시지 (Device=1) = 31
그림 10. 충돌된 서비스 요청메시지 (Device=2) = 32
그림 11. 서비스 제공 전달시간 (평균값) = 33

more

목차

표목차
표 1. 강의 어플리케이션을 위한 access matrix = 8
표 2. Individual mode에서의 세션 테이블 = 9
표 3. Group mode에서의 세션 테이블 = 10
표 4. Supervised mode에서의 세션 테이블 = 11
표 5. 어플리케이션 서비스에 따른 서비스 구성 테이블 = 13
표 6. 서비스 충돌회피를 위한 수정된 서비스 세션 테이블 = 20
표 7. 시뮬레이션 파라메터 = 28

more